Output d8eacacc01881baa93721de46feaaea7a22ec3a48f6ce4a2aaec3f54ebca3697:2

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 11fcaf2312c2baf9ba57e27a5452d2c3ee86384e
address
tb1qz8727gcjc2a0nwjhufa9g5kjc0hgvwzw2r8l6n
transaction
d8eacacc01881baa93721de46feaaea7a22ec3a48f6ce4a2aaec3f54ebca3697